Ordinals
beta
Address 3622NcfxoRif1nVQSGwPscP1u32Qg3ymEi
sat balance
100100000
outputs
0d7324e2b0167e4e83d53ea435bea4757c020fe1d1b2430a4dae9b937ba9f897:7
ee88c141b962799133841c9338b82a3bd59bba8019c3691e57cb652eacb340c3:5